A damaged, leaky roof is one of the most feared home repairs because discovering and correcting a leak isn’t generally uncomplicated.
Discolored or drooping sheetrock, flaking paint, or an obvious drip are all signs of a roof leak. However, even a small undiscovered leak can trigger broken insulation, mildew development, and decayed wood structure. A leak can also move and spread out from the original broken area to another part of your residential or commercial property.

The majority of roof leakages in Malverne, New York are triggered by reasonably normal circumstances that harm your roof.
Your roof will never have a bad day, yet aging is unavoidable. All roofing products are prone to severe climate condition such as rainstorms, freeze/thaw cycles, high temperatures, and extreme summertime sun, which might eventually cause early aging, breaking, and curling of the shingles.
Brick chimneys appear to be strong, however the mortar that holds the bricks together, as well as the flashing and chimney crown, can be readily damaged. Water may enter into the attic through cracks, rust, and punctures.
A leak can be easily triggered by missing out on or broken shingles. Individual shingle replacement is typically not a major concern, but stopping working to get it repaired might result in more damaged shingles and more expensive repairs.
The vents on your roof system consist of exposed fasteners that will fracture, deteriorate, and age with time. This is a small repair, however it is a common source of leakages since most vents do not last the life of the roof.
The plumbing boot slips over a pipeline to safeguard the pipe’s connection to the roof. The boot, like the vents and flashing, can be harmed, fracture, and fail. The repair isn’t especially challenging, although damage can be quickly ignored.
Storm damage, strong winds, and hail may all cause big and small holes. Some holes are evident, but others may go undiscovered for years up until an examination reveals them. Water can get in through even small holes triggered by lost roofing nails, the removal of an antenna or dish installing bracket, or impact-related fissures in roofing materials.
A complex, convoluted roofline may be rather attractive, but it is likewise more difficult to waterproof. Every joint, valley, and slope needs to be marked.
Roof products struggle to withstand freeze-thaw cycles, in addition to ice and snow. Water might slip into microscopic spaces in between and under shingles when snow accumulates, melts, and refreezes. Water swells and deepens the crack as it freezes. The weight of the snow and ice can also cause flexing and sagging of the flashing and plywood foundation.
Seamless gutters may posture problems if they are not cleaned and fixed on a routine basis. Rainwater can back up behind a obstruction and penetrate through the shingles, damaging the wood beneath. Standing water can likewise cause damage to older seamless gutters.
Skylights, like chimneys and pipeline vents, have some of the very same issues. Aside from potential flashing damage, the rubber or vinyl seals around skylights may dry up and fracture; at this moment, the skylight should be replaced.
Wetness can develop in your attic as a result of ventilation issues, and this can simulate a roof leak. In order to effectively evacuate warm air and moisture from your attic area, your roof needs to have sufficient intake and exhaust ventilation. This can result in wood rot, mold, and damaged insulation, and it has the possible to be a very expensive repair.
The greatest protection against roof leaks is to schedule a yearly roof inspection and to act quickly if you suspect a leak.
Wood shake is one of the roofing materials that is a choice of some homeowners for a visual outcome of their houses, though not generally commonly utilized by many residential owners and even in commercial applications. Wood shakes or shingles are usually made from cedar, a coniferous growing tree known for its natural residential or commercial properties and features. By and big, cedar roof can be a good choice for quality roofing.
Cedar is a hard-wearing and extremely attractive kind of wood, with color tones differing from red to light amber and some in a honey-brown appearance. The type of material makes it an affordable choice because of its resilience. Additionally, it can also be the perfect choice as an outside building product, not simply for roof however likewise for sidings.

A cedar wood is at first being cut or slated and is cut and squared according to its usage either for roofing or siding. A cedar shingle ranges from 8 to 20 cm broad and its thickness likewise differs. And considering that the dimension of each cedar shingle is not consistent, no 2 cedar shakes or shingles are precisely the exact same. Cedar shingles are also commonly called the cedar roofing shakes. After slating and forming each shingle into its appropriate dimension, the material is being treated with chemicals or Class B or C fire retardant for resistance from fire. Other chemical treatments are for prevention of moss development and mildew and fungal decay which are the natural enemies of cedar roofing. To make it an even more ideal roofing material, the slated shingles are kiln dried or undergo a heating system process.
The option for cedar roofing does not simply contribute a look of beauty and style on your house but it adds to sturdiness purposes. Because it is dealt with and kiln dried, the product becomes resistant to insects and moss or fungal development. Cedar roofing, being a natural insulator, keeps your home interior cool and cozy throughout hot season and sustains warmth during cold environments.

Elastomeric Roofing
roof or rubber roofing, as it is frequently called, is one kind of artificial roofing material that is a structure of recycled rubber. This rubber is being cracked off in the rubber mill and the small chips are combined with various chemicals to make the RRPV (Recycled Rubber Poyurethane Elastomer) or the EPDM (Ehtylene Propylene Diene Monomer). To be able to come up with ultra violet (UV) filtering ability, manufacturers of rubber roof frequently include crushed stone, slate, or limestone to the mix. It likewise improves the appearance of the product and its sturdiness.
However prior to the building work is left for the day, roofing contractors must have already ended up using the membrane roof underlayment. reason for this is to avoid water to get in when rain occurs suddenly as this will wet up the interiors of the structure like the plywood and insulation board. And if this happens without awareness, there is a huge tendency that eventually wetness on the insulation board or the plywood will cause the product to be quickly damaged.
Elastomeric roof may be applied with elastomeric finish in liquid form and "rubber-like" protective membranes. Appropriate coating choice should be done, as not all elastomeric coverings are the exact same. Your roofing expert can get you the finest recommendations on this.
As compared to clay tile roofing, elastomeric roofing is 100% percent water resistant due to the fact that of its anti-porous property. This type of roofing material can last from 40 years onwards, depending on the resilience of the rubber.
reside in a location where temperature level can go as low as 20 degree Celsius, don't ever think about using this kind of roof product. Elastomeric roofings are not extremely flexible in low temperatures.
